My Daughter loaded limewire ages ago, when my computer crashed in december, the tech uninstalled limewire and other programs when he was reconfiguring the computer.
We recently downloaded Limewire again but when I go to start the installation process, I get a warning - "An older version of LimeWire appears to be running. You must exit the old version before continuing with installation. Once you have exited LimeWire, click Retry" (Note that LimeWire may be running in your system tray. To exit, right-click on the lime icon and choose "Exit".) I searched my computer and can't find any other occurance of LimeWire. Someone please help! |

It sounds like the computer tech uninstalled limewire the wrong way...
Have a look in Start > All Programs > Limewire/uninstaller, if you see the uninstaller click on it... If not try a computer search (Start > Search) using the terms limewire.exe and if anything shows up delete it... Also just check your Task Manager (Ctrl-Alt-Delete) go to Processes and see if Limewire is running, if it is select the End Now option and then use the limewire uninstaller...
